In a saucepan, combine the milk, lemon zest, and vanilla sugar. Heat over medium heat until the mixture is just about to boil.
Meanwhile, in a separate bowl, whisk together the egg yolks, sugar, and cornstarch until the mixture is smooth and well combined.
Slowly pour the hot milk mixture into the egg yolk mixture, stirring continuously to avoid cooking the eggs.
Once everything is well incorporated, allow the mixture to cool completely.
After cooling, add the lemon juice and sweetened condensed milk. Whisk until the mixture thickens to your desired consistency.
For an elegant touch, decorate your dessert with a sprinkle of cinnamon, a dusting of cocoa powder, or chocolate shavings—whichever suits your taste.
Transfer the dessert to the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to set. This helps the flavors meld together and gives the dessert a perfect texture.
